How Smart Rings Measure Stress & Recovery

Understanding the science behind stress monitoring helps you make informed decisions about your health and recovery.

HRV (Heart Rate Variability) Explained

HRV measures the variation in time between heartbeats, reflecting your autonomic nervous system’s ability to adapt to stress. The best smart ring for recovery tracking uses advanced algorithms to analyze these patterns.

  • RMSSD measurement captures parasympathetic activity
  • Lower HRV often indicates elevated stress levels
  • Nighttime readings provide most reliable baseline

Resting Heart Rate & Stress

Elevated resting heart rate trends can indicate accumulated stress or insufficient recovery. Smart rings for stress monitoring track these patterns continuously.

  • Baseline deviations signal stress accumulation
  • Recovery signals during deep sleep phases
  • Weekly trends more meaningful than daily fluctuations

Sleep Stage Integration

Sleep stages provide crucial context for recovery analysis. Deep sleep facilitates nervous system reset, while REM sleep supports cognitive recovery.

  • Deep sleep correlates with physical recovery
  • REM sleep supports emotional regulation
  • Sleep efficiency impacts recovery quality

Readiness & Recovery Scores

Smart ring readiness score algorithms combine multiple metrics to provide actionable daily guidance for training and stress management decisions.

  • Composite scoring from HRV, sleep, and heart rate
  • Personalized baselines improve accuracy
  • Daily performance optimization guidance

Practical Implementation Guide

Learn how sleep tracking rings work and implement effective stress monitoring strategies for optimal health outcomes.

Getting Started with Stress Monitoring

1

Establish Your Baseline

Wear your ring consistently for 2-3 weeks to establish reliable HRV and recovery baselines. Avoid making major lifestyle changes during this period.

2

Track Lifestyle Factors

Log sleep quality, exercise intensity, alcohol consumption, and stress events to understand what impacts your recovery metrics.

3

Focus on Trends

Pay attention to weekly patterns rather than daily fluctuations. Consistent downward trends in HRV may indicate accumulated stress.

4

Implement Recovery Strategies

Use low readiness scores as signals to prioritize sleep, reduce training intensity, or practice stress management techniques.

Smart Ring App Usage

Optimizing Your Stress Management Strategy

Sleep Optimization

Prioritize 7-9 hours of quality sleep. Use ring data to identify optimal bedtimes and wake times for your circadian rhythm. Consider exploring sleep tracker rings for insomnia if you experience sleep difficulties.

Stress Management

Implement breathing exercises, meditation, or yoga when HRV trends decline. Track the impact of different stress reduction techniques on your recovery metrics.

Exercise Adaptation

Adjust training intensity based on readiness scores. High-intensity workouts on low-recovery days can compound stress and delay adaptation.
